How to Take It
Best taken in the evening
The Magnesium in it is what pulls this toward the evening. Take it with food — the zinc and potassium in it are what makes this kind of product feel nauseating on an empty stomach.

The score analyzes what's on the label: ingredient doses vs. clinical ranges, chemical forms, evidence levels, and known interactions. It does not verify label accuracy or test for contaminants — for that, look for third-party certifications like USP or NSF.
